Is cooking a hard skill?

Hard skills are concrete skills that are specific to your job and are required for you to actually do your work. For example, if you’re a chef, cooking would be a hard skill. … Soft skills, on the other hand, are interpersonal or people skills that can be used in every job.

What is the role of a cook?

The cook will prepare meals and follow establishment recipes. Duties include preparing ingredients, adhering to the restaurant menu, and following food health and safety procedures. Cook, clean, assist other cooks and staff and deliver food in a fast-paced environment.

What it takes to be a cook?

While there are no postsecondary education requirements to work as a cook, many restaurants, cafeterias, and other food service establishments prefer that applicants have at least a high school diploma. Taking courses in math can help prospective cooks with measuring ingredients and calculating portions.

What are the 3 methods of cooking?

Types of Cooking Methods. The three types of cooking methods are dry heat cooking, moist heat cooking, and combination cooking. Each of these methods uses heat to affect foods in a different way. All cooking techniques, from grilling to steaming, can be grouped under one of these three methods.
